HTML viewing problem

1999-11-20 Thread Mike Liddekee

I'm having some difficulty and I'm not sure if its the application or
my setup.  I've been using TheBat since about v1.34 and am currently
using v1.38b2.  Anyway my problem is when i receive an HTML message it
appears to show up fine but if it contains images, all that displays
is a box w/ a exclamation point in it.  Can anyone point out why this
might occur.

It worked this way always. TB is not a web browser, and as 
such it *doesn't* automatically download the images from the 
web in the case when they are *not* supplied in the e-mail 
message. 

OTOH it will display the HTML with images provided that the 
images were sent to you together with the HTML page via e-
mail.
